Sophie Turner Early Life: The Choice That Changed Everything
Sophie Belinda Turner was born on February 21, 1996, in Northampton, England. Growing up in a large Edwardian house near Leamington Spa, her childhood was far from the glitz of Hollywood. Her mother, Sally, was a nursery school teacher, and her father, Andrew, worked in distribution.
The defining moment of Sophie Turner’s early life came at age 11. A gifted dancer, she was offered a spot at the prestigious Royal Ballet School. However, her passion for the stage won out. She turned down the ballet to stay with the Playbox Theatre Company, a decision that led her drama teacher to encourage her to audition for a new HBO fantasy series.
The Sansa Stark Era: A Masterclass in Public Growth
In 2011, the world met the Sansa Stark actress. At just 14 years old, Turner began filming a role that would span nearly a decade. Unlike many child stars, Turner effectively learned to act on camera, with her character evolving from a naive noblewoman into a powerful political survivor.
The Impact of Sansa Stark on the Sophie Turner Biography
The role was both a blessing and a burden. Turner has been vocal about the “biological clock” of child stardom, noting that she spent her most formative years living as a fictional character. This period established her Expertise in high-pressure environments, but it also exposed her to intense public scrutiny regarding her body and mental health.

Sophie Turner Career After Westeros: Rebuilding and Redefining
After Game of Thrones ended in 2019, Turner faced the post-franchise challenge. While she starred as Jean Grey in the X-Men films (Apocalypse and Dark Phoenix), she has recently spoken about the loss of career momentum during the early 2020s.

In 2024, she made a critically acclaimed return to television in the crime drama Joan, playing diamond thief Joan Hannington. She credited this role with helping her find her acting mojo again after a hiatus focused on family.
The 2026 Renaissance: Becoming Lara Croft
The biggest news of 2026 is undoubtedly Turner’s induction into the video game hall of fame as the new Lara Croft. Led by creator Phoebe Waller-Bridge, the Prime Video Tomb Raider series is positioned as a contemporary, high-octane thriller.
Key Details of the 2026 Tomb Raider Production
-
The Original Take: Turner explicitly stated in a January 2026 SiriusXM interview that she is avoiding previous iterations (Angelina Jolie and Alicia Vikander) to create a version of Lara that is both elite and emotionally vulnerable.
-
On-Set Resilience: Despite suffering a minor injury during filming in late March 2026, Turner was back on set at the British Museum within weeks, proving her dedication to the physical demands of the role.
-
The Casting: She stars alongside Martin Bobb-Semple (Zip), Jason Isaacs, and Sigourney Weaver, forming one of the most prestigious ensembles in streaming history.
Personal Life: Motherhood and Living Authentically
Turner’s personal life has often been under the microscope. She was married to musician Joe Jonas from 2019 to 2024, and they share two daughters, Willa and Delphine.
In recent 2026 interviews, Turner has been candid about Mom Guilt and the benefits of being a young mother in her 20s. Now based in London, she has become a vocal advocate for mental health. And she is openly discussing her past struggles with eating disorders and the pressures of social media.
